RingCentral - New company level call trigger

The New company level call trigger retrieves new company level calls made by the connected RingCentral account. The trigger checks for new company level calls every five minutes.

Ensure the connected RingCentral account has Read Call Log permissions. These permissions are typically enabled for predefined or default RingCentral roles.

Input

FieldDescription
Trigger poll intervalSpecify how frequently to check for new events. Defaults to five minutes if left blank. The minimum allowed value is five minutes.
When first started, this recipe should pick up events fromSpecify the start time to retrieve calls received since this time. Defaults to one hour before the recipe is first started if left blank. Refer to Triggers to learn more about this input field.
